#!/bin/bash
set -e
echo "🚀 Starting GitpodFlix Environment..."
# Colors for output
RED='\033[0;31m'
GREEN='\033[0;32m'
YELLOW='\033[1;33m'
BLUE='\033[0;34m'
NC='\033[0m' # No Color
# Function to print colored output
print_status() {
echo -e "${BLUE}[INFO]${NC} $1"
}
print_success() {
echo -e "${GREEN}[SUCCESS]${NC} $1"
}
print_warning() {
echo -e "${YELLOW}[WARNING]${NC} $1"
}
print_error() {
echo -e "${RED}[ERROR]${NC} $1"
}
# Function to wait for service with timeout
wait_for_service() {
local service_name=$1
local check_command=$2
local timeout=${3:-60}
local interval=${4:-2}
print_status "Waiting for $service_name to be ready..."
for i in $(seq 1 $((timeout / interval))); do
if eval "$check_command" >/dev/null 2>&1; then
print_success "$service_name is ready!"
return 0
fi
if [ $i -eq $((timeout / interval)) ]; then
print_error "Timeout waiting for $service_name after ${timeout}s"
return 1
fi
echo -n "."
sleep $interval
done
}
# Function to check if port is in use
check_port() {
local port=$1
if timeout 5 netstat -tlnp 2>/dev/null | grep -q ":$port "; then
return 0
else
return 1
fi
}
# Function to kill process on port
kill_port() {
local port=$1
local pid=$(timeout 5 netstat -tlnp 2>/dev/null | grep ":$port " | awk '{print $7}' | cut -d'/' -f1 | head -1)
if [ ! -z "$pid" ] && [ "$pid" != "-" ]; then
print_warning "Killing process on port $port (PID: $pid)"
kill -9 $pid 2>/dev/null || true
sleep 2
fi
}
# Step 1: Clean up any existing services
print_status "Cleaning up existing services..."
# Stop any existing Docker containers
docker stop main-postgres-1 2>/dev/null || true
docker rm main-postgres-1 2>/dev/null || true
docker stop postgres 2>/dev/null || true
docker rm postgres 2>/dev/null || true
# Kill processes on our ports
kill_port 3000
kill_port 3001
kill_port 5432
print_success "Cleanup completed"
# Step 2: Start PostgreSQL Database
print_status "Starting PostgreSQL database..."
cd database/main
if ! docker-compose up -d; then
print_error "Failed to start PostgreSQL with docker-compose"
exit 1
fi
# Wait for PostgreSQL container to be healthy
print_status "Waiting for PostgreSQL container to be healthy..."
if ! wait_for_service "PostgreSQL Container" "docker-compose ps postgres | grep -q '(healthy)'" 90 5; then
print_error "PostgreSQL container failed to become healthy"
docker-compose logs
exit 1
fi
# Wait for database connection and schema to be ready
if ! wait_for_service "PostgreSQL Database" "PGPASSWORD=gitpod psql -h localhost -U gitpod -d gitpodflix -c 'SELECT 1'" 30 2; then
print_error "PostgreSQL database connection failed"
docker-compose logs
exit 1
fi
# Verify database schema is ready (migrations have run)
print_status "Verifying database schema..."
if ! wait_for_service "Database Schema" "PGPASSWORD=gitpod psql -h localhost -U gitpod -d gitpodflix -c 'SELECT 1 FROM information_schema.tables WHERE table_name = '\''movies'\'''" 30 2; then
print_error "Database schema not ready - migrations may not have completed"
docker-compose logs
exit 1
fi
# Additional buffer time to ensure database is fully stable
print_status "Allowing database to stabilize..."
sleep 5
cd ../..
# Step 3: Install and start Backend Catalog Service
print_status "Setting up Backend Catalog Service..."
cd backend/catalog
# Create .env file if it doesn't exist
if [ ! -f .env ]; then
print_status "Creating .env file..."
cat > .env << EOF
DB_HOST=localhost
DB_USER=gitpod
DB_PASSWORD=gitpod
DB_NAME=gitpodflix
DB_PORT=5432
PORT=3001
EOF
fi
# Install dependencies
print_status "Installing backend dependencies..."
npm install
# Start the service in background
print_status "Starting catalog service..."
nohup npm run dev > /tmp/catalog.log 2>&1 &
CATALOG_PID=$!
# Wait for catalog service to be ready
if ! wait_for_service "Catalog Service" "curl -s http://localhost:3001/health" 30 2; then
print_error "Catalog service failed to start"
print_error "Logs:"
tail -20 /tmp/catalog.log
exit 1
fi
cd ../..
# Step 4: Install and start Frontend
print_status "Setting up Frontend..."
cd frontend
# Install dependencies
print_status "Installing frontend dependencies..."
npm install
# Start the service in background
print_status "Starting frontend service..."
nohup npm run dev > /tmp/frontend.log 2>&1 &
FRONTEND_PID=$!
# Wait for frontend to be ready
if ! wait_for_service "Frontend" "curl -s http://localhost:3000" 30 2; then
print_error "Frontend failed to start"
print_error "Logs:"
tail -20 /tmp/frontend.log
exit 1
fi
cd ..
# Step 5: Seed the database
print_status "Seeding database with sample data..."
# Double-check database is ready before seeding
if ! PGPASSWORD=gitpod psql -h localhost -U gitpod -d gitpodflix -c "SELECT COUNT(*) FROM information_schema.tables WHERE table_name = 'movies'" >/dev/null 2>&1; then
print_error "Database schema not ready for seeding"
exit 1
fi
if [ -f "database/main/seeds/movies_complete.sql" ]; then
print_status "Seeding database from SQL file..."
if PGPASSWORD=gitpod psql -h localhost -U gitpod -d gitpodflix -f database/main/seeds/movies_complete.sql >/dev/null 2>&1; then
print_success "Database seeded with sample movies"
else
print_error "Failed to seed database from SQL file"
# Try API fallback
print_status "Attempting API seeding fallback..."
if curl -s -X POST http://localhost:3001/api/movies/seed >/dev/null 2>&1; then
print_success "Database seeded via API fallback"
else
print_warning "Could not seed database - continuing anyway"
fi
fi
else
# Fallback to API seeding
print_status "SQL seed file not found, using API seeding..."
if curl -s -X POST http://localhost:3001/api/movies/seed >/dev/null 2>&1; then
print_success "Database seeded via API"
else
print_warning "Could not seed database - continuing anyway"
fi
fi
# Step 6: Final health checks
print_status "Performing final health checks..."
# Check PostgreSQL
if PGPASSWORD=gitpod psql -h localhost -U gitpod -d gitpodflix -c "SELECT COUNT(*) FROM movies" >/dev/null 2>&1; then
MOVIE_COUNT=$(PGPASSWORD=gitpod psql -h localhost -U gitpod -d gitpodflix -t -c "SELECT COUNT(*) FROM movies" | xargs)
print_success "PostgreSQL: ✅ ($MOVIE_COUNT movies in database)"
else
print_error "PostgreSQL: ❌ Database connection failed"
fi
# Check Backend API
if curl -s http://localhost:3001/health >/dev/null 2>&1; then
print_success "Backend API: ✅ http://localhost:3001"
else
print_error "Backend API: ❌ Not responding"
fi
# Check Frontend
if curl -s http://localhost:3000 >/dev/null 2>&1; then
print_success "Frontend: ✅ http://localhost:3000"
else
print_error "Frontend: ❌ Not responding"
fi
# Step 7: Display summary
echo ""
echo "🎬 GitpodFlix Environment Ready!"
echo "================================"
echo "Frontend: http://localhost:3000"
echo "Backend API: http://localhost:3001"
echo "Database: PostgreSQL on port 5432"
echo ""
echo "Service PIDs:"
echo "- Catalog Service: $CATALOG_PID"
echo "- Frontend: $FRONTEND_PID"
echo ""
echo "Logs available at:"
echo "- Backend: /tmp/catalog.log"
echo "- Frontend: /tmp/frontend.log"
echo "- Database: docker logs main-postgres-1"
echo ""
print_success "All services are running successfully! 🚀"
